; rlm_filewrite.conf ; ; This is the sample configuration file for the 'rlm_filewrite' RLM for ; Rivendell, which can be used to write one or more files on the local ; system using Now & Next data. ; ; To enable this module, add it to the 'Loadable Modules' list in ; RDAdmin->ManageHosts->RDAirPlay->ConfigureNow&Next. The 'Argument' ; field should point to the location of this file. ; Section Header ; ; One section per file to be written should be configured, starting with ; 'File1' and working up consecutively [File1] ; Filename ; ; The full path to the file to be written. The user running RDAirPlay ; must have write permissions for this location. Filename=/tmp/rlm_filewrite.txt ; Append Mode ; ; If set to '0', the file will be completely overwritten with the contents ; of each PAD update. If set to '1', each update will be appended to the ; existing contents of the file. Append=0 ; Format String. The string to be output each time RDAirPlay changes ; play state, including any wildcards as placeholders for metadata values. ; ; The list of available wildcards can be found in the 'metadata_wildcards.txt' ; file in the Rivendell documentation directory. ; FormatString=NOW: %d(ddd MMM d hh:mm:ss yyyy): %t - %a\nNEXT: %D(ddd MMM d hh:mm:ss yyyy): %T - %A\n ; Encoding. Defines the set of escapes to be applied to the PAD fields. ; The following options are available: ; ; 0 - Perform no character escaping. ; 1 - "XML" escaping: Escape reserved characters as per XML-v1.0 ; 2 - "Web" escaping: Escape reserved characters as per RFC 2396 Section 2.4 Encoding=0 ; Log Selection ; ; Set the status for each log to 'Yes', 'No' or 'Onair' to indicate whether ; state changes on that log should be output. If set to 'Onair', then ; output will be generated only if RDAirPlays OnAir flag is active. MasterLog=Yes Aux1Log=Yes Aux2Log=Yes ; Additional files can be written by adding new sections... ; ;[File2] ;Filename=/home/rd/foo2.txt ;Append=1 ;FormatString=%t by %a\r\n ;MasterLog=Yes ;Aux1Log=No ;Aux2Log=Onair
